動詞
- 1. talk with excessive pride and self-satisfaction about one's achievements, possessions, or abilities she boasted about her many conquests he boasted that he had taken part in the crime 同義詞 反義詞
- 2. (of a person, place, or thing) possess (a feature that is a source of pride) the hotel boasts high standards of comfort 同義詞
名詞
- 1. an act of talking with excessive pride and self-satisfaction I said I would score, and it wasn't an idle boast 同義詞
